Performance breakdown
Aesthetic Appeal
Authentic Art Deco geometry makes this a stunning centerpiece for any bar.
Seal Integrity
The traditional cork seal provides a reliable, period-accurate closure for shaking.
Build Quality
Heavy-duty silver-plating reflects the superior craftsmanship of Sheffield metalwork.
Straining Efficiency
Integrated strainer handles standard cocktails well but lacks modern fine-mesh precision.
Collector Value
Hallmarked provenance ensures this piece retains significant historical and investment appeal.
Ergonomic Handling
Balanced weight and classic proportions make for a comfortable, confident pour.
